原文:NSRunLoop原理详解——不再有盲点

编程最怕的就是有盲点,不确定,而runloop官网对其提及的又很少 那么看完这篇应该使你有底气很多 RunLoop整体介绍 An event processing loop, during which events are received and dispatched to appropriate handlers. 事件运行循环:就类似下面的while循环部分,当然要复杂很多,可以把它抽象成如 ...

2017-02-23 21:21 2 5567 推荐指数:

查看详情

[iOS]浅谈NSRunloop工作原理和相关应用

一. 认识NSRunloop 1.1 NSRunloop与程序运行    那么具体什么是NSRunLoop呢?其实NSRunLoop的本质是一个消息机制的处理模式。让我们首先来看一下程序的入口——main.m文件,一个ios程序启动后,只有短短的十行代码居然能保持整个应用程序一直 ...

Sun Aug 28 05:13:00 CST 2016 0 5039
SqlSugar 盲点

1、读取数据库连接 private SqlSugarClient GetInstance() { string conmstring = System.Web.Configuration.WebC ...

Fri May 18 00:17:00 CST 2018 0 2728
iOS 中NSRunLoop的使用

一、RunLoop的使用示例 1、 #import <UIKit/UIKit.h> #import <CoreFoundation/CoreFoundation.h> ...

Sun Sep 09 08:04:00 CST 2012 0 6561
NSRunLoop的一点理解

一、类定义   + (NSRunLoop *)currentRunLoop     如果调用的线程中没有runloop,那么将会创建一个并返回  + (NSRunLoop *)mainRunLoop     返回主线程的runloop   - (void)acceptInputForMode ...

Sun Jan 06 09:27:00 CST 2013 3 7034
【前端盲点】事件的几个阶段你真的了解么???

前言 前端时间我写过几篇关于事件的博客: 【移动端兼容问题研究】javascript事件机制详解(涉及移动兼容) 【探讨】javascript事件机制底层实现原理 结果被团队的狗蛋读了,发现其中一块”特别“的地方,然后之后读了Barret Lee 的一篇博客:[解惑 ...

Wed Feb 26 08:20:00 CST 2014 15 13953
NSPort与NSRunloop的关系是流与消息调度的关系

NSPort与NSRunloop的关系是流与消息调度的关系。 NSPort 将流插入到消息调度队列; 相当于 Socket将流插入到应用一样 - (void)launchThread { NSPort *myport = [NSMachPort port ...

Wed Apr 18 00:22:00 CST 2018 0 875
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M